What is a release of liability and indemnity agreement?
A release and indemnity agreement, also called an indemnity agreement or a hold harmless agreement, is a legal contract that releases a party from specific liabilities. Essentially, one party in the contract agrees to pay for all potential losses or damages caused by the other party.
What is the difference between indemnification and waiver of liability?
In a legal sense, an indemnity clause is simply something that's part of a liability waiver. It helps clarify that the person signing the clause (the indemnifier) is agreeing to remove liability from the business so they can participate in the related activity, event, or service.
What is the meaning of liability waiver agreement?
A liability waiver form is a legal contract that educates one party about the risks associated with an activity. Once signed, it prevents the participant from opening a lawsuit against the company in the event of damage or loss, effectively shifting responsibility for injuries from the company to the customer.

What are the three types of indemnification?
This makes the subcontractor the indemnitor who agrees to save and hold harmless the general contractor (the indemnitee) and, usually, the owner. There are three basic types of indemnities. From an insurance perspective, the indemnities are broken down into limited form, intermediate form, and broad form.

What is the difference between indemnification and liability?
Indemnity is concerned only with the causation, but not with remoteness. Damages under a liability clause are limited by causation, remoteness, and foreseeablity. Further, the damages should also be reasonable, even if there is a liquidated damages clause.
How do I write a liability waiver?
How to create a liability waiver List the names and addresses of the parties. Give the date of the agreement and how long it is in effect for. List the location of the event or activity. Describe the activity or event the customer is going to participate in. List the possible risks and injuries.

What is Participation Agreement, Waiver of Liability, and Indemnification?
A Participation Agreement is a contract that outlines the terms and conditions under which an individual or group agrees to participate in an event or activity. A Waiver of Liability is a legal document that releases an organization or individual from potential legal claims resulting from the participation in the activity. Indemnification is a provision that holds one party harmless for any losses or damages incurred by another party.
Who is required to file Participation Agreement, Waiver of Liability, and Indemnification?
Typically, participants in activities organized by companies, organizations, or event planners are required to file these documents. This can include athletes, event attendees, volunteers, or anyone engaging in activities that could pose risks.
How to fill out Participation Agreement, Waiver of Liability, and Indemnification?
To fill out these forms, participants should provide their personal information, acknowledge understanding of the risks involved, agree to the terms laid out in the documents, and sign and date the forms. It may also require the signature of a guardian if the participant is a minor.
What is the purpose of Participation Agreement, Waiver of Liability, and Indemnification?
The purpose is to protect organizations from legal claims related to injuries or damages that may occur during the activities. It ensures that participants understand the risks and agree to assume those risks, thereby limiting the liability of the organizing party.
What information must be reported on Participation Agreement, Waiver of Liability, and Indemnification?
The information typically includes participant's name, contact information, emergency contact details, acknowledgment of risks, agreement to waive liability, and signatures. Some forms may require specific details about the activity or event in question.
